Copplestone is a small, unmanned station. There is no ticket office or machine at the station, so purchasing tickets in advance online is essential. It's worth noting there's no facility for collecting tickets bought online here. While there is no waiting room, a seating area is available for those moments before your train arrives. The station offers step-free access, though wheelchair users might find it challenging to board trains due to narrow platforms. A customer help point is available, ensuring help is on hand if needed.
With no refreshment facilities, shops, or ATMs, travelers should plan accordingly. For assistance or inquiries, patrons can reach out to the GWR Help & Support.
Copplestone is well-connected by local transport and offers a convenient rail replacement service toward Barnstaple and Exeter. For a seamless transition from train to other modes of transport, schedules and maps can be printed beforehand via this link. While there are no designated taxi ranks or car hire facilities, nearby bus stops on the A377 provide an alternative route for onward travel.

Ruskington Station might be small, but it certainly doesn't fall short in providing essential services for passengers. While it lacks a dedicated ticket office, travelers can conveniently use ticket machines to collect pre-purchased tickets. If you're someone needing a little extra help, you'll be comforted to know that help points are available, with information services ready to assist. It’s worth noting that smartcards cannot be issued here, though validators are on hand for quick access.
The concern for safety is evident with the presence of CCTV, providing peace of mind as you navigate through the station. For passengers who need it, an induction loop is available. While you won't find waiting rooms, seating areas, or refreshment facilities, you'll be pleased to know that the car park operates 24 hours and provides free parking—ideal for travelers planning on driving to the station.
Ruskington Station not only connects passengers to various railway destinations but also integrates other forms of transport to ease your onward journey. Rail replacement services are conveniently located in the station car park. If you're planning on exploring the local area or require a taxi service, reliable numbers for nearby taxi services, such as Sleaford Station Woodside and GT, are at your disposal.
For those who prefer public transport, bus service information is accessible online, helping you plan further travel effortlessly. Whether you’re using public transport or personal means, getting to and from Ruskington is made simple with these facilities.
